re PR target/86787 (iq2000 port needs updating for CVE-2017-5753)
authorNick Clifton <nickc@redhat.com>
Thu, 2 Aug 2018 12:14:52 +0000 (12:14 +0000)
committerNick Clifton <nickc@gcc.gnu.org>
Thu, 2 Aug 2018 12:14:52 +0000 (12:14 +0000)
PR target/86787
* config/iq2000/iq2000.c (TARGET_HAVE_SPECULATION_SAFE_VALUE):
Define to speculation_safe_value_not_needed.

From-SVN: r263255

gcc/ChangeLog
gcc/config/iq2000/iq2000.c

index 48511fe6309cca24c0e45fcdc2fae0b03ec155d8..ca8b9ba051d419d5ce397340ed06803ec8febf81 100644 (file)
@@ -1,12 +1,16 @@
 2018-08-02  Nick Clifton  <nickc@redhat.com>
 
+       PR target/86787
+       * config/iq2000/iq2000.c (TARGET_HAVE_SPECULATION_SAFE_VALUE):
+       Define to speculation_safe_value_not_needed.
+
        PR target/86782
        * config/frv/frv.c (TARGET_HAVE_SPECULATION_SAFE_VALUE): Define to
        speculation_safe_value_not_needed.
 
        PR target/86781
-       * config/fr30/fr30.c (TARGET_HAVE_SPECULATION_SAFE_VALUE): Define to
-       speculation_safe_value_not_needed.
+       * config/fr30/fr30.c (TARGET_HAVE_SPECULATION_SAFE_VALUE): Define
+       to speculation_safe_value_not_needed.
 
 2018-08-02  Richard Sandiford  <richard.sandiford@arm.com>
 
index ee89ced0e2f0f2d23c635a81a508ea4ac061b7ae..4b30a44a4506e25c9e7d1e1b74d7883c447cd305 100644 (file)
@@ -274,6 +274,9 @@ static HOST_WIDE_INT iq2000_starting_frame_offset (void);
 #undef  TARGET_STARTING_FRAME_OFFSET
 #define TARGET_STARTING_FRAME_OFFSET   iq2000_starting_frame_offset
 
+#undef  TARGET_HAVE_SPECULATION_SAFE_VALUE
+#define TARGET_HAVE_SPECULATION_SAFE_VALUE speculation_safe_value_not_needed
+
 struct gcc_target targetm = TARGET_INITIALIZER;
 \f
 /* Return nonzero if we split the address into high and low parts.  */